To turn Auto Play ON or OFF go to My Computer, right-click on the drive that you want to turn Auto Play ON or Off and go to Properties at the bottom of the resulting menu. Click properties and then click on the AutoPlay tab. This will bring up a properties window with single box followed by a larger box below. Using the arrow at the right of the smaller box, scroll to the item that you want to change. Choose the player that you want to play the DVD movie, Dvd video, CD or whatever and click apply/OK att he bottom. You'll notice that I have a couple od choices in each catagory.
